Representative Subjective Outcome Scores for Athletes After Anterior Cruciate Ligament Reconstruction
| Type of Scale | Description |
|---|---|
| Nominal | |
| RTS question | A dichotomous (yes/no) response to the question “Have you returned to the same level of competition as before your injury?” |
| Continuous | |
| Lysholm | The Lysholm scale measures the domains of symptoms and complaints and measures functioning in daily activities. It is scored on a scale of 0 to 100. The scale does not measure the domain of functioning in sports and recreational activities. |
| IKDC | The IKDC consists of 18 questions that stress the effects of symptoms, activities of daily living, and sports activities on the knee, while also accounting for total knee function on a converted scale from 0 to 100. |
| SANE | The SANE is an index for evaluating the current subjective knee condition, with a score from 0 to 100. |
| PoSAP | The PoSAP is an index for evaluating the current subjective athletic performance compared with before anterior cruciate ligament injury, scored as a percentage from 0% to 100%. |
IKDC, International Knee Documentation Committee; PoSAP, postoperative subjective athletic performance; RTS, return to sports; SANE, Single Assessment Numeric Evaluation.

Agreement Between PoSAP and Response to the RTS Question
| PoSAP Score, % | RTS “Yes,” n | RTS “No,” n |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Cutoff 100% | 100 | 15 | 0 | κ = 0.294; |
| <100 | 18 | 11 | ||
| Cutoff 90% | ≥90 | 27 | 1 | κ = 0.632; |
| <90 | 6 | 10 | ||
| Cutoff 80% | ≥80 | 28 | 1 | κ = 0.676; |
| <80 | 5 | 10 | ||
| Cutoff 70% | ≥70 | 31 | 5 | κ = 0.533; |
| <70 | 2 | 6 |
PoSAP, postoperative subjective athletic performance; RTS, return to sports.
